excel sumifs函数计算结果为0?为什么
6个回答
展开全部
在准备二级office计算机考试的时候发现这样一道题:
在“2013年图书销售分析”工作表中,统计2013年各类图书在每月的销售量,并将统计结果填充在所对应的单元格中。
但是按照答案=SUMIFS(表1[销量(本)],表1[图书名称],[@图书名称],表1[日期],">=2013-1-1",表1[日期],"<=2013-1-31")
回车之后却得到一排0
开启分步阅读模式
工具材料:
Excel2010以上版本
操作方法
01
首先需要检查一下,需要引用表格中的单元格格式问题。确保日期格式,以及其他的文本格式
02
若是还是数值为0
将公式更改为=SUMIFS(表1[销量(本)],表1[图书名称],[@图书名称],表1[日期],">="&"2013-1-1",表1[日期],"<="&"2013-1-31")
特别提示
注意]">="&"日期",
注意“”符号的格式
注意在之后的几个月份中2月有28天,所以是
应该又是单元格中写入了文本数字,再用SUM函数进行求和得出0值了吧
试按如下方法进行解决
1,电子表格如何自动求和?
假设数字写在A1至A100单元格,则公式可以写成
=SUM(A1:A100)
2,文本的数值怎么自动求和?
假设你的文本数字写在A1至A100单元格,则公式可以写成
=SUMPRODUCT(--A1:A100)
3.如何把文本直接转换成数值?
方法一
选中单元格----右键----设置单元格格式---改"文本"为"常规"格式---再进入单元格回车确认.如果是大批量的单元格是文本格式的数值,则要一个一个的进入单元格进行回车确认,所以很不方便.
方法二
选中一个空单元格----右键----复制----再选中文本格式所在的单元格和单元格区域----右键----选择性粘贴---加---确定.这样就是通过运算的方法使选中的单元格或单元格区域进行加0处理使其转为常规数字的方式.
方法三
选中文本格式数值所在的单元格或单元格区域------在选中的单元格或单元格区域旁会出现一个选项图标----点击会出现选项菜单----选择"转为数字"
方法四
选中整列为文本格式的列----数据----分列----完成---再右键---设置单元格格式为常规---确定
在“2013年图书销售分析”工作表中,统计2013年各类图书在每月的销售量,并将统计结果填充在所对应的单元格中。
但是按照答案=SUMIFS(表1[销量(本)],表1[图书名称],[@图书名称],表1[日期],">=2013-1-1",表1[日期],"<=2013-1-31")
回车之后却得到一排0
开启分步阅读模式
工具材料:
Excel2010以上版本
操作方法
01
首先需要检查一下,需要引用表格中的单元格格式问题。确保日期格式,以及其他的文本格式
02
若是还是数值为0
将公式更改为=SUMIFS(表1[销量(本)],表1[图书名称],[@图书名称],表1[日期],">="&"2013-1-1",表1[日期],"<="&"2013-1-31")
特别提示
注意]">="&"日期",
注意“”符号的格式
注意在之后的几个月份中2月有28天,所以是
应该又是单元格中写入了文本数字,再用SUM函数进行求和得出0值了吧
试按如下方法进行解决
1,电子表格如何自动求和?
假设数字写在A1至A100单元格,则公式可以写成
=SUM(A1:A100)
2,文本的数值怎么自动求和?
假设你的文本数字写在A1至A100单元格,则公式可以写成
=SUMPRODUCT(--A1:A100)
3.如何把文本直接转换成数值?
方法一
选中单元格----右键----设置单元格格式---改"文本"为"常规"格式---再进入单元格回车确认.如果是大批量的单元格是文本格式的数值,则要一个一个的进入单元格进行回车确认,所以很不方便.
方法二
选中一个空单元格----右键----复制----再选中文本格式所在的单元格和单元格区域----右键----选择性粘贴---加---确定.这样就是通过运算的方法使选中的单元格或单元格区域进行加0处理使其转为常规数字的方式.
方法三
选中文本格式数值所在的单元格或单元格区域------在选中的单元格或单元格区域旁会出现一个选项图标----点击会出现选项菜单----选择"转为数字"
方法四
选中整列为文本格式的列----数据----分列----完成---再右键---设置单元格格式为常规---确定
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
用sumifs函数得不到正确的结果的原因可能是单元格格式错误,公式错误或计算选项是自动。正确的计算方法是:
打开Excel工作簿。
在通过函数统计数据时,需要首先检查数据区域是否存在着无法被函数利用的无效数据(文本数据),将其通过“转换”为数值的形式,保持函数的有效运用和计算结果的准确。
复制数据区域外的任一空单元格,然后选择数据区域,单击鼠标右键,“选择性粘贴”为“运算”“加”,即可将文本数据转换为可被函数有效利用的“数值”。
完成上述转换后,结果单元格会返正确的结果。
打开Excel工作簿。
在通过函数统计数据时,需要首先检查数据区域是否存在着无法被函数利用的无效数据(文本数据),将其通过“转换”为数值的形式,保持函数的有效运用和计算结果的准确。
复制数据区域外的任一空单元格,然后选择数据区域,单击鼠标右键,“选择性粘贴”为“运算”“加”,即可将文本数据转换为可被函数有效利用的“数值”。
完成上述转换后,结果单元格会返正确的结果。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
我测试了下,函数本身写法是没有问题,但是要注意B列中数据类型,如果数据类型设置为文本型是无法进行计算,见下图1和2,1图数据类型为数值型,合计结果为6900;2图数据类型为文本型,合计结果为0.
有问题可以追问,记得采纳我哈
有问题可以追问,记得采纳我哈
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
B列内容是不是文本格式,如果请转换为数值
EFG三列如果有空格,请删除
EFG三列如果有空格,请删除
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
广告 您可能关注的内容 |